Transaction dd5447c6a63dadb552153d4183678779206e6a13e1c2a861053158e926d623a8
1 Input
1 Output
-
dd5447c6a63dadb552153d4183678779206e6a13e1c2a861053158e926d623a8:0
- value
- 5803147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c017688ddbaf176b003386c2d909e984a3bb71e OP_EQUAL
- address
- 32nVnVsM3MKURpo4XfWzE1QbuTFKJXunQv